IPCC 2021 Scholarship Programme for Developing Countries - Switzerland

The aim of the IPCC Scholarship Programme is to build capacity in the understanding and management of climate change in developing countries through providing opportunities for young scientists from developing countries to undertake studies that would not be possible without the intervention of the Fund.

Applications from Least Developed Countries (LDCs) and Small Island Developing States (SIDS) researching topics with the fields of study chosen for the call for applications are given priority.

Benefits of IPCC PhD Scholarship

Each scholarship award is for a maximum amount of 15,000 Euros per year for up to two years during the period 2021-2023.

Requirements for IPCC PhD Scholarship

  1. The IPCC will accept applications from PhD students that have been enrolled for at least a year or are undertaking post-doctoral research.
  2. Applicants should be citizens of a developing country with priority given to students from Least Developed Countries (LDCs) and Small Island Developing States (SIDS).

Selection Criteria: 

Applications will be submitted to a two-level selection process. IPCC scientific experts will assess the applications in a first review. The IPCC Science Board will then review the applications and make a final selection of candidates to receive the awards.
